Many Ca Mau electric taxi drivers went on strike after the director banged on the table and said 'disband'

Over the past two days, many Nam Thang electric taxi drivers in Ca Mau have gone on strike to protest the company's policies, which they consider unsatisfactory.

On January 1, Mr. Pham Hoang Nho - a driver of Bao Gia Ca Mau Joint Stock Company (Nam Thang Ca Mau electric taxi) - said that he and about 100 other people went on strike and waited for other policies from the company after the director of this electric car company held a meeting but after only about 15 minutes, he banged on the table and requested to disperse.

In a 37-second clip posted on social media, a lawyer explains to company employees about their rights, then suddenly Mr. Ho Hoang Anh - director of Bao Gia Ca Mau Joint Stock Company - stands up and bangs on the table, demanding "I'm here to say this, if you don't do it, we'll be dismissed". Immediately, more than 100 people attending the company meeting left because of the director's actions.

The drivers said the reason they went on strike on New Year’s Day was because the company had introduced new policies that pressured employees. Among them were policies that forced drivers to pay for charging electric vehicles, while previously promising employees that the company would fully cover this cost.

In addition, contracted employees said that there were many unreasonable points in the agreement compared to reality. Although the vehicle was required to be serviced and maintained every 12,000 km, many drivers had to drive more than double the prescribed number of km but still could not get their vehicles serviced, and some tires were even worn out and of poor quality.

Many drivers also said that the company set a revenue target of 28 million VND for drivers to receive a salary of 8 million VND/month, which is too much for a small province like Ca Mau, which has nearly 200 electric cars and many other taxi companies. The high revenue target makes many drivers have to work day and night to hope to achieve it, which makes driving unsafe. Some employees said that when signing the contract, it mentioned insurance for employees, but in reality, some people have been working for many months and have not been covered by insurance.

In addition, taxi drivers are also upset that many vehicles have not been purchased two-way auto insurance by the company, forcing the driver to take responsibility in the event of an accident.

Tuoi Tre Online contacted Mr. Ho Hoang Anh - director of Bao Gia Ca Mau Joint Stock Company (the person banging on the table) - and was told that "he is on a business trip, not at home, there is no problem, it is just some agitators, he is out of the province, not knowing when he will return so he cannot meet him".
